SN11 Friday update, for March 19, 2021: The test campaign for Starship appears to be taking a ‘Spring Break weekend’, with no additional static fire attempts following Monday’s partial test. Due to the public roadway passing by the worksite, tests requiring road closure generally do not occur on weekends.
